Our Team
The Elevation Kiteboarding team is a group of enthused kiteboarders who love what they do and enjoy sharing their passion with students. Our instructors are IKO (International Kiteboarding Organization) certified with years of experience teaching students of all levels. Our aim is to teach independent, safe and successful kiteboarders! After 11 years in business, we pride ourselves on being one of the original kite schools in the world with two North American locations that allow us to teach nearly year round with a team that continue to come back each year.
Marie-Christine Leclerc

Owner

Marie is from Quebec and started kiteboarding in 2002. She has pushed kiteboarding limits and established Elevation Kiteboarding as a premier school on the west coast of Canada and Mexico. She has been teaching since 2005 and has taught hundreds of students with her attention to detail, safe and positive approach. Her teaching techniques and uplifting attitude have inspired and educated many of the people you will meet at Nitinat Lake and in La Ventana. Elevation Kiteboarding School has an excellent and experienced team thanks to Marie’s vision and skills.

Mark Bavis

Gear Specialist / Duotone Kiteboarding Retailer

Mark comes from a background of sailboat racing on the coast of New Brunswick. As kites became available in 2000, Mark saw the potential for another form of sailing and became a kiteboarding pioneer. Mark is a Duotone Kiteboarding retailer for both of our teaching locations and is the go-to for gear questions.

Robin Bowles

Instructor – Advanced Kiteboarding Specialist

Robin comes from the UK and has been kiteboarding since 2002 and an IKO instructor since 2004. Robin has a skillful background in skateboarding and snowboarding. He has devoted thousands of hours to freestyle riding and has logged as many hours teaching.

Robin loves to use film and video to show his students their riding style as a method to improve technique.
